How Roxika 150mg Tablet works:

Roxika 150mg tablets are antibacterial agents. Their mechanism of action involves inhibiting the production of crucial bacterial proteins, thereby disrupting essential bacterial processes. This halts bacterial proliferation and controls the spread of infection.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holSAFE

There are no known adverse reactions associated with ingesting alcohol alongside Roxika 150mg tablets.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Pregnant individuals can generally use Roxika 150mg tablets safely. Animal research indicates minimal or no negative impacts on fetal development; however, human data is scarce.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Lactation and Roxika 150mg tablets are compatible. Research in human subjects indicates negligible drug transfer into breast milk, posing no known ris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king a Roxika 150mg T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Roxika 150mg tablets are likely safe for individuals with kidney impairment. Preliminary findings indicate dose modification may be unnecessary, however, phys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Roxika 150m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Roxika 150mg Tablet :

Should you forget a Roxika 150mg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
